In a message dated 10/10/09 21 58 50, detomasoregistry at gmail.com writes:
> There are round wrap, round non-wrap, flat-wrap, and flat non-wrap
> versions for the front.
>
Actually, no. There are two styles of flat-edge bumpers (wrap and
non-wrap, if you like), but only one style of round edge bumpers (not counting the
European L-model bumpers). They are listed specifically as such in the De
Tomaso parts book--and on the 'bumpers' page in the De Tomaso registry. :>)
One style of flat-edge bumper was apparently used only on European cars
(but which one? The wrap, or non-wrap style? I don't remember).
The Ford parts book only lists two styles (not bothering with the European
Pre-L, or European L styles), and says that the changeover happened with
chassis #2840.
